Creating 300 dpi (dot per inch or pixel per inch) resolution images (TIFF file) are required to submit figures to scientific research journals for publication. In most cases figures are assembled in Microsoft Office PowerPoint for presentation as well as for publication. This video shows a simple way of converting each PowerPoint slides into a 300 dpi image (.TIFF file) for publication. Adobe Photoshop is required for this process and resolution can be increased or reduced. It works for both Windows and Mac.
